简体中文简体中文
EnglishEnglish
简体中文简体中文

面试技巧揭秘:如何在面试中展现你的源码能力

2025-01-08 07:25:53

随着互联网行业的蓬勃发展,源码能力成为了程序员的核心竞争力之一。在求职过程中,面试无疑是检验程序员源码能力的重要环节。本文将为你揭秘如何在面试中展现你的源码能力,助你在求职路上脱颖而出。

一、面试前的准备

1.熟悉源码

在面试前,你需要对所申请的职位相关的源码进行深入研究。了解其功能、架构、技术特点等,以便在面试中能够熟练地回答面试官关于源码的问题。

2.编程实践

在面试前,通过编程实践来提高自己的源码能力。可以尝试自己实现一些项目,或者对开源项目进行修改和完善。这样,在面试中,你就能更好地展示自己的源码能力。

3.学习源码阅读技巧

阅读源码是提高源码能力的关键。学会阅读源码,可以帮助你更好地理解项目,发现潜在的问题。以下是一些阅读源码的技巧:

(1)从整体架构入手,了解项目的主要功能模块。

(2)关注关键代码,如核心算法、性能优化等。

(3)了解代码风格,如命名规范、注释等。

(4)分析代码逻辑,理解代码背后的设计思路。

二、面试中的表现

1.展现自信

面试中,自信的态度可以给面试官留下深刻的印象。在回答问题时,保持镇定,展现自己的实力。

2.逻辑清晰

在回答面试官关于源码的问题时,要注意逻辑清晰。先阐述自己的观点,再结合实际案例进行论证。

3.突出重点

在回答问题时,要突出重点。不要过多地描述细节,而是抓住关键点,让面试官了解你的源码能力。

4.举例说明

在面试中,举例说明自己的源码能力非常重要。可以通过以下方式展示:

(1)分享自己参与的项目,介绍自己在项目中的职责和贡献。

(2)展示自己的编程作品,如开源项目、个人博客等。

(3)针对面试官提出的问题,现场编写代码进行演示。

5.诚实回答

在面试中,诚实回答问题非常重要。如果遇到不会的问题,可以如实告知,并表示自己会努力学习。

三、面试后的总结

1.反思

面试结束后,要对自己的表现进行反思。分析自己在哪些方面做得好,哪些方面还有待提高。

2.学习

针对自己在面试中暴露出的问题,制定学习计划,提高自己的源码能力。

3.求职经验分享

将自己在面试中的经验和心得总结成文章,分享给其他求职者,帮助他们更好地准备面试。

总之,在面试中展现自己的源码能力,需要你在面试前做好充分准备,面试中保持自信、逻辑清晰,并举例说明。同时,面试后的总结和学习也非常重要。相信通过不断努力,你一定能够在求职路上取得成功。